Ben Hardy in Queen biopic

Ben Hardy has been roped in to essay the role of drummer Roger Taylor in a biopic on the band Queen.

"Ben caught the eye of producers and he has worked with director Bryan Singer on X-Men. After a couple of screen tests, the makers decided he was the perfect man for the job and signed him up. He's very excited," a source says.

"But he's got plenty of work to do before filming starts. He's only just started taking drumming lessons to get up to scratch," the source adds.

He will star alongside Rami Malek in the upcoming biopic that will follow Queen's journey up to their appearance at the Live Aid concert in 1985. 

Movie makers are still busy trying to cast two more actors to take on the roles of Brian May and John Deacon.
